چکیده

Glioblastoma multiforme (GBM) is most frequently located in the supratentorial region of the brain. In this paper, we report the case of a 25-year-old man who presented with a heterogeneous tumor with exophytic features and located in the caudal fourth ventricle. The tumor was subtotally resected and the patient underwent radiotherapy at a dosage of 50 Gy and concurrent chemotherapy with temozolomide. Histopathological examination revealed the typical features of conventional GBM. The patient independently performed the activities of daily living for 11 months. However, after identifying a recurrence of the tumor in the dorsal medulla oblongata, the patient suddenly died at home 12 months after diagnosis, likely due to respiratory arrest. To the best of our knowledge, it is extremely rare for GBM to occur in the medulla oblongata and only eight cases have been described in detail. Patients with intrinsic GBM of the medulla oblongata died within three months. In contrast, patients with exophytic GBMs of the medulla oblongata survived for more than one year. Patients with GBMs that occurred in the medulla oblongata and exhibited exophytic growth patterns had a better prognosis than patients with intrinsic GBMs because the tumors could be more radically and safely resected.
